No water in Kent, CT21

We’re really sorry you haven’t got any water. We’ve been made aware of a burst water main in your area which may be causing this.

What we’re doing

The team are on site looking to repair the issue.

What you can do

Until we’ve sorted this, please avoid using your:

  • Washing machine
  • Dishwasher
  • Electrical appliances that use water

If you still have water, we recommend you put some in your kettle or fridge for drinking in case your water needs switching off for the repair.

We’re really sorry about this, we’re working to get your water back to normal as soon as possible.
